2025 Autors: Lynn Donovan | [email protected]. Pēdējoreiz modificēts: 2025-01-22 17:33
Lai dekompilēt klases failu , vienkārši atveriet jebkuru no jūsu Java projektus un dodieties uz Maven atkarības bibliotēkām, lai skatītu jar faili iekļauts jūsu projektā. Vienkārši izvērsiet jebkuru jar fails kuriem jums nav pievienots avots Aptumsums un noklikšķiniet uz. klases fails.
Ņemot to vērā, kā dekompilēt kara failu?
- Izveidojiet sava.war faila kopiju > sakiet copy.war.
- Pārdēvējiet faila copy.war paplašinājumu uz copy.zip.
- izpakojiet šo failu.
- Atrodi. klases failus izspiestajā mapē.
- Pēc tam lietotāju atkopšanas programmas pārveido šos.class failus atpakaļ par.java failiem. Google par dekompilatoriem: Cavaj Java Decompiler.
Tāpat kā komandu uzvednē dekompilēt klasi? Lai komandrindā dekompilētu failu grupu, palaidiet šādas komandas:
- Izveidojiet direktoriju, kurā atradīsies jūsu izejas Java faili.
- Palaidiet komandu, lai dekompilētu failus: java -jar jd-cli. jar -od.
Kā šajā sakarā skatīt.class failu?
A klases fails ir binārā formātā. Jūs varat atvērt un skats to var izmantot jebkurš teksta redaktors, piemēram, notepad operētājsistēmā Windows un vi operētājsistēmā Mac. Bet, lai iegūtu Java kodu no a klases fails , varat izmantot vai nu sekojošo: Izmantojiet dekompilatoru, piemēram, Java Decompiler.
Vai jūs varat dekompilēt Java?
Tu ir gatavi dekompilēt Java klases fails no Eclipse. Lai dekompilēt klases failu, vienkārši atveriet jebkuru no jūsu Java projekti un dodieties uz Maven atkarības bibliotēkām, lai skatītu jūsu projektā iekļautos jar failus. klases fails. Tagad tu vari skatiet šī faila pirmkodu Java redaktors, vienkārši un eleganti, vai ne.
Ieteicams:
Kādas ir divas izņēmuma klases Java izņēmuma klases hierarhijā?
Izņēmuma klasei ir divas galvenās apakšklases: IOException klase un RuntimeException klase. Tālāk ir sniegts visbiežāk pārbaudīto un neatzīmēto Java iebūvēto izņēmumu saraksts
Kā palaist Java klases failu citā direktorijā?
Tālāk ir norādītas darbības, lai palaistu java klases failu, kas atrodas citā direktorijā: 1. darbība (izveidot lietderības klasi): Izveidojiet A. 2. darbība (Utilīta klases kompilēšana): atveriet termināli proj1 vietā un izpildiet šādas komandas. 3. darbība (pārbaudiet, vai A. 4. darbība (ierakstiet galveno klasi un kompilējiet to): Pārvietojieties uz savu proj2 direktoriju
Vai varat dekompilēt EXE?
Jā, jūs varat dekompilēt failu .exe un iegūt avota kodu trīs veidos, kā es zinu (un varbūt iespējams arī citos veidos:)) Šeit ir sniegts soli pa solim Windows lietojumprogrammas dekompilēšanas veids: NET Decompiler un tā papildinājums. programmā FileDisassembler, kas agrāk bija bezmaksas versija, taču tā vairs nav bezmaksas
Vai ir iespējams dekompilēt DLL?
Īsa atbilde: jūs nevarat. Gara atbilde: C/C++ kompilācijas process ir ļoti zaudējumus. Labākajā gadījumā esmu dzirdējis par dažiem rīkiem, kas var sniegt jums daļēju dekompilāciju, un šeit un tur tiek atpazīti C koda biti, taču jums joprojām būs jāizlasa daudz montāžas koda, lai to saprastu
Kā dekompilēt kara failu?
Izveidojiet faila your.war kopiju > sakiet copy.war. Pārdēvējiet faila copy.war paplašinājumu uz copy.zip. izpakojiet šo failu. Atrodi. klases failus izspiestajā mapē. Pēc tam lietotāju atšifrētāji konvertē this.class failus atpakaļ uz.java failiem. Google par dekompilatoriem: Cavaj Java Decompiler